#6f3970 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f3970 is composed of 43.5% red, 22.4%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 49.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 33.1%. #6f3970 color hex could be obtained by blending #de72e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#6f3970 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.

#6f3970 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6f3970 has RGB values of R:111, G:57,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7289200.

Shades and Tints of #6f3970

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080408 is the darkest color, while #fcf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f3970

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565356 is the less saturated color, while #a105a4 is the most saturated one.
